Which solar panel should you choose in 2025?
Choosing the right solar panel in 2025 depends on your priorities—efficiency, budget, or sustainability. Monocrystalline panels remain the top choice for their high efficiency and sleek design, perfect for maximizing energy on limited roof space. Bifacial panels, capturing sunlight from both sides, are gaining traction for ground-mounted systems. For eco-conscious buyers, thin-film panels, often made from recycled materials, offer flexibility and lower environmental impact. Also, consider advancements like high-efficiency heterojunction (HJT) panels, blending durability with cutting-edge performance. Assess your energy goals, roof capacity, and budget, and consult with a solar expert to navigate 2025's evolving technologies for the best fit.
What solar panel power is needed for energy independence?
The power needed for solar panel autonomy depends on your energy consumption, location, and system efficiency. Start by calculating your average daily energy usage in kilowatt-hours (kWh). In sunny regions like California, 1 kW of solar panels generates about 4-5 kWh daily. For complete energy independence, most U.S. households require a 6-10 kW system, translating to 15-25 panels. Include a battery storage system to cover nighttime and cloudy days. Factors like roof space, shading, and weather also impact performance. Consulting a solar professional ensures accurate sizing and a tailored setup to meet your autonomy goals efficiently and effectively.

The science of solar panels: converting sunlight to power
Photovoltaic panels convert sunlight into electricity. To maximize their efficiency, there is good that be installed in a sunny location with the correct orientation and tilt in relation to the sun. This ensures a high energy output. A quality installation remains essential for optimized solar panel performance. Despite cloudy weather, panels can still produce electricity. Technological advancements have increased solar panel efficiency up to 20%. It home worth noting that solar panels we do not produce greenhouse gases and remain a clean, renewable energy source. In this respect, choosing a suitable location and completing a careful installation home crucial for fully benefiting from solar panels.
